Pennsylvania nonprofit organizations help the public and are essential to our society. They help improve communities around the country and make our lives better in art, science, economics, health, culture, human services, civil rights, religion, the environment, education, and many other fields.

Public support and confidence are essential to the success of nonprofit organizations. People, businesses, foundations, and government at all levels support nonprofits by giving resources, time, and money. The code has six Guiding Principles and 26 areas for ethical, responsible, and effective organizations. It is based on the legal foundations of how nonprofit organizations are run and governed. The code emphasizes values such as honesty, integrity, equity, fairness, respect, trust, compassion, responsibility, and transparency. The Institute and PANO encourage all nonprofit organizations to follow the code and work to be excellent in their management, governance, and operations.

The code is designed for 501(c)(3) organizations and is also applicable to 501(c)(4) and 501(c)(6) organizations. These organizations rely on public support and value transparency. The current code includes some limitations on lobbying and political activity for 501(c)(3)s that do not apply to 501(c)(4) and 501(c)(6) organizations.
